Over the last ten years, South Korean cinematography has been swept by a new wave that has greatly contributed to the overall boom of Asian cinematography. Every year the country produces a rich mix of genres and personal styles – commercial and independent productions, multi-million dollar blockbusters and festival films that are appreciated well beyond its borders. South Korean films in recent years have regularly competed at film festivals and are beginning to find their ways to western film distribution networks, including ours. So it is only fitting to begin our little excursion among South Korean filmmaking newcomers with the film that started it all when it was the first to win an award in Cannes in 1999.
